Course summary
Societies on the Water is an interesting course with field trips and diverse assignments, though some find it scattered. It's good for students interested in social sciences or photography, but may be challenging due to heavy group work.
Grading isn't very generous; some students got A’s while others received B’s despite heavy workload.
Workload is heavy with group projects and field assignments. Students spend several hours per week on the course.
Assessments include a project, possibly interviews and photo work, but no mention of midterms or finals.
The professor seems engaging enough for some students, though one review mentions it could be more structured.
Be prepared to do extensive group work and manage free-riding teammates. The course can be challenging without clear structure.
